MEMO — Board

Re: Overhaul of the Kestrel Rewards programme.

Current tiers are unprofitable and redemption liability is growing. Proposal: collapse four tiers to two, shift earn rates to margin-weighted points, sunset legacy balances over twelve months. Marketing projects modest churn among low-value members, offset by improved unit economics. Implementation cost is within the approved envelope. Vote requested at the next session. Supporting rationale follows below.

board note of yadup-fajef: Druiusox Holdings is in early talks to buy Norwynek Systems for about $186.0 million. The Kaseth launch date is June 24, and nothing goes to the press before then. Legal wants the Quenethek Group term sheet withdrawn before November 27.

**Vendor note: Inkmill markdown pipeline**

Rendering for Parchway docs is outsourced to Inkmill under an annual contract, renewing each March. They handle sanitization and PDF export; we own the upload queue. SLA: 4-hour response on rendering failures. Escalate only after two failed retries. Their support desk is reachable at the address below.

billing contact of hahaf-baguf = zorael.tammir.jorius@sivrelhq.internal

# NOTE (userland split, Phase 2):
# User module moved out of the Bextral monolith.
# Legacy user tables are frozen — do not add columns.
# New identity service owns writes; monolith reads via views.
# Remove this shim after release 9.1 ships.
# The identity datastore is reached with the following connection string.

replica DSN, yahaf-yagaf: mongodb://tamath_svc:a2netSk3RZMuTj@db-d084.novacsoft.internal:5432/ralmir